数据库模型图形是什么
-
数据库模型图形是一种用于表示和描述数据库结构的可视化工具。它通过图形化的方式展示数据库中的表、字段、关系以及约束等元素,帮助开发人员和数据库管理员更好地理解和管理数据库。
数据库模型图形通常使用实体-关系(ER)模型来描述数据库的结构。在ER模型中,实体代表数据库中的一个对象或概念,关系表示实体之间的联系。通过绘制实体和关系之间的连接线,可以清晰地表示数据库中表之间的关系。
在数据库模型图形中,每个表都用一个方框表示,方框中包含表的名称。表中的字段则以列的形式展示,每个字段都有一个名称和数据类型。表之间的关系可以用连接线表示,连接线上还可以标注关系的类型,如一对一、一对多、多对多等。
除了表和字段之外,数据库模型图形还可以展示其他重要的信息,如主键、外键、索引、约束等。主键用特殊的标识符表示,外键则通过箭头指向关联的表。索引可以用特殊的符号或颜色表示,约束则可以用不同的线条类型表示。
通过数据库模型图形,开发人员和数据库管理员可以更加直观地了解数据库的结构,方便进行数据库设计、优化和维护工作。同时,数据库模型图形也可以作为文档,用于记录和传递数据库设计和结构信息。
1年前 -
数据库模型图形是一种图形化的表示数据库结构和关系的工具。它用于描述数据库中的表、字段、关系和约束等元素,并通过图形化的方式展示它们之间的关系。数据库模型图形通常使用特定的符号和图形元素来表示不同的数据库对象和关联关系,使得数据库结构更加直观和易于理解。
以下是关于数据库模型图形的五个重要点:
-
实体和关系:数据库模型图形通常包含实体和关系两个主要的元素。实体代表数据库中的表或对象,而关系表示不同实体之间的关联关系。通过在图形中使用适当的符号和连接线,可以清晰地展示实体之间的关系,如一对一、一对多、多对多等。
-
属性和约束:数据库模型图形还可以展示实体的属性和约束。属性是实体的特定特征或字段,用于存储具体的数据。约束是对属性或关系的限制条件,如主键、外键、唯一性约束等。通过在图形中使用不同的符号和标记,可以明确表示每个属性的数据类型、长度、默认值和约束等信息。
-
数据流和过程:除了实体和关系,数据库模型图形还可以展示数据流和过程。数据流表示数据在不同实体之间的流动路径,用于描述数据的输入、输出和转换过程。过程表示数据库中的操作或功能,如查询、插入、更新和删除等。通过使用合适的符号和箭头,可以清晰地表示数据流和过程之间的关系和依赖性。
-
数据库设计:数据库模型图形是数据库设计的重要工具。通过使用图形化的方式,数据库设计人员可以更好地理解和沟通数据库结构和关系。他们可以使用图形工具创建、修改和优化数据库模型,以满足实际需求。数据库模型图形还可以帮助识别和解决数据库设计中的问题,如冗余数据、性能瓶颈和数据一致性等。
-
文档和维护:数据库模型图形还可以用于生成数据库文档和进行数据库维护。通过使用图形工具,可以自动生成数据库的结构和关系文档,以便开发人员和管理员更好地理解和操作数据库。数据库模型图形还可以帮助识别和解决数据库维护中的问题,如备份和恢复、性能优化和安全性管理等。
1年前 -
-
数据库模型图形是用来描述数据库结构和关系的图形化表示工具。它可以展示数据库中的表、表之间的关系以及属性等信息。通过数据库模型图形,可以清晰地了解数据库的结构,方便开发人员、数据库管理员和其他相关人员进行数据库设计、开发和维护工作。
数据库模型图形一般分为以下几种类型:
-
概念模型图形(Conceptual Model Diagram):概念模型图形用于描述数据库中的实体、属性和实体之间的关系。它通常使用实体-关系图(Entity-Relationship Diagram,简称ER图)来表示。ER图由实体、属性和关系三个主要元素组成,通过连接线表示实体之间的关系。
-
逻辑模型图形(Logical Model Diagram):逻辑模型图形用于描述数据库中的表、列和表之间的关系。它一般使用关系图(Relational Diagram)来表示。关系图由表、列和关系三个主要元素组成,通过连接线表示表之间的关系。
-
物理模型图形(Physical Model Diagram):物理模型图形用于描述数据库中的表、列和表之间的关系,并且考虑到了具体的数据库管理系统(DBMS)的特性。它一般使用物理模型图(Physical Model Diagram)来表示。物理模型图由表、列和关系三个主要元素组成,通过连接线表示表之间的关系,并且可以添加数据库管理系统特定的属性。
在数据库模型图形中,常用的符号和标记包括:
-
实体(Entity):用矩形表示,表示数据库中的一个对象,如人、物、事物等。
-
属性(Attribute):用椭圆形表示,表示实体的特征或属性。
-
关系(Relationship):用菱形表示,表示实体之间的关系或联系。
-
主键(Primary Key):用下划线标记,表示唯一标识一个实体的属性。
-
外键(Foreign Key):用虚线箭头标记,表示一个实体与另一个实体之间的关系。
绘制数据库模型图形可以使用各种数据库设计工具,如ERWin、PowerDesigner、MySQL Workbench等。这些工具提供了丰富的图形化界面和功能,方便用户进行数据库设计和管理工作。
1年前 -